This
sexy page-turner of a novel offers wonderful entertainment. It will
take you back to 1978 and all of its tumultuous events. It will give
you a contemporary and ultimately thought-provoking look at the times
of Harvey Milk, and his legacy to us all.
Jessica has it all. An expensive condo in the
city of dreams, San Francisco. A high-powered, prestigious career
as a management consultant that takes her all over the country...
To passionate Roberta, in Chicago. To delicious Marilyn, in San Antonio.
To all those cities and all those willing women Jessica has recorded
in her well-used little black book.
Sex with these women doesn't really mean a thing,
Jessica tells herself. It's all just good times. Because she is
not really a lesbian. No, of course not. Her sexual adventures are
merely keeping her occupied until she decides to settle down ...
with a man.
Then she meets Cat, the alluring young hotel executive
who lives across the hall from her new condo. What is Jessica to
make of her chaotic feelings, her yearning -- and yes, her deepening
love -- for the sensuous, captivating Cat, who offers entrancing
friendship, but nothing more?
